57: Standards and guidance

You could also call this:

"Rules and advice for government agencies to follow"

A system leader can set standards for their area if the Minister agrees. You need to know that these standards are only for public service agencies. The system leader and the Minister must put the standards in writing.

A system leader can also give guidance for their area. This guidance applies to all State services, not just public service agencies. The guidance must also be in writing.

Chief executives are in charge of making sure their agencies follow the standards. They must make their agencies implement the standards that apply to them. This helps keep everything consistent and fair.

Part 3People working in public service
Public service chief executives, system leaders, and public service leadership team: System leaders

57Standards and guidance

  1. If the appropriate Minister agrees, a system leader may set standards relating to the particular subject matter area that they lead and co-ordinate.

  2. A system leader may also issue guidance relating to that particular subject matter area.

  3. The standards and guidance must be in writing.

  4. Those standards apply only in or to public service agencies.

  5. Chief executives must ensure that the agencies that they lead or carry out some functions within implement the standards that apply in or to them.

  6. Guidance issued by a system leader applies in or to all State services.
